About 12-Point SignWorks
12-Point SignWorks offers custom design & build services for branded corporate interiors and environmental graphics. We also specialize in the design, fabrication and installation of effective vehicle advertising wraps for cars, trucks, vans, trailers, and more. ur staff is dedicated to providing a high quality service experience for our clients in accordance with our 12-Point's Guiding Values.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Franklin?

Understanding the cost of living near Franklin is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at 12-Point SignWorks.
Franklin's Cost of Living Index is approximately 120.8 (20.8% more expensive than US average; 33.9% more than TN average). Affluent Nashville suburb (Williamson Co.), historic, very high housing costs. TMA Group/WeGo.
